What should you do if you are unsure about how to help a victim in an emergency?

In an emergency situation where you are uncertain about how to assist a victim, calling for emergency assistance and following the dispatcher’s instructions is the best course of action. This option ensures that trained professionals are alerted to the situation, which is critical for providing the necessary support and care. Dispatchers can offer specific guidance based on the nature of the emergency, advising you on what steps to take while you wait for help to arrive.

Additionally, following the instructions from emergency services allows you to help the victim safely without putting yourself in danger or worsening their condition. This is especially important in cases where the nature of the emergency is not clear, and taking uninformed actions could lead to further harm. By seeking professional assistance, you ensure that the victim receives the appropriate care needed while you act as a supportive presence until help arrives.
